About Birth Injury Law in Yangambi, DR Congo

Birth injury law in Yangambi, DR Congo addresses legal issues related to injuries sustained by newborn babies during the birthing process. These injuries can be caused by medical negligence, improper procedures, or failure to provide appropriate care during childbirth.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What are common types of birth injuries that can occur in Yangambi, DR Congo?

A: Common birth injuries in Yangambi include cerebral palsy, brachial plexus injuries, and fractures. These injuries can result from medical errors, oxygen deprivation, or trauma during delivery.

Q: How can I prove that a birth injury was caused by medical negligence?

A: Proving medical negligence in a birth injury case requires gathering medical records, expert testimony, and other evidence to demonstrate that the healthcare provider failed to adhere to the standard of care during childbirth.

Q: What compensation can I seek for a birth injury in Yangambi?

A: Victims of birth injuries in Yangambi can seek compensation for medical expenses, rehabilitation costs, pain and suffering, and loss of future earning capacity. The amount of compensation will depend on the severity of the injury and its long-term effects.

Q: Can I file a birth injury claim on behalf of my child in Yangambi?

A: Yes, parents or legal guardians can file a birth injury claim on behalf of a child who has suffered an injury during childbirth. The compensation received will be used for the child's medical care and future needs.
